What’s Sachetisation?

 

The time period ‘sachetisation’ originates from the patron items business, the place important merchandise like shampoo, detergent, and even tea are provided in small, reasonably priced sachets. This idea permits shoppers to purchase merchandise in portions they’ll afford relatively than in bulk. In an identical means, the SEBI proposed Sachetisation in mutual funds, enabling small-ticket investments that make market participation accessible for low-income teams.

Sachetisation in mutual funds means permitting traders to start out investing with a really small quantity— as little as Rs. 250 monthly. The Securities and Alternate Board of India (SEBI) has championed this initiative to encourage monetary inclusion, making certain that even these with minimal financial savings can spend money on India’s rising mutual fund business. As per Livemint report, the mutual fund business has seen spectacular development lately, with Belongings Below Administration (AUM) growing from ₹10 trillion in 2014 to ₹68.08 trillion as of November 2024. In parallel, the variety of distinctive mutual fund traders has surged from 1.7 crore in 2018 to five.18 crore by late 2024. Regardless of such development, there’s a important hole in reaching out to the plenty.

Proposed Key Options of Sachetised Mutual Funds

 

The sachetisation of mutual funds comes with particular options designed to make investing accessible and handy for small traders, reminiscent of:

 

1. Low Minimal Funding

Traders can begin with as little as Rs. 250 monthly by way of a Systematic Funding Plan (SIP). This removes the standard entry barrier of upper minimal investments.

 

2. Restricted Variety of SIPs

To make sure a measured strategy, Traders can begin with a small SIP of ₹250, with a most of three such SIPs throughout completely different AMCs. This supplies an reasonably priced entry level for these with restricted disposable revenue, additionally stopping overexposure whereas permitting diversification.

 

3. Simple Fee Strategies

To encourage participation, mutual funds enable funds by way of auto-pay strategies such because the Nationwide Automated Clearing Home (NACH) and Unified Fee Interface (UPI). This ensures that small traders can contribute effortlessly with out coping with complicated banking procedures.

 

4. Distributor Incentives

To advertise monetary inclusion, SEBI has provided incentives for the distributors and execution solely platforms (EOPs) to achieve out to underserved populations, making certain that extra persons are made conscious of those alternatives.

 

5. Exclusion of Sure Funds

Sachetisation is primarily aimed toward secure, low-to-medium-risk funding classes. In consequence, high-risk mutual funds, reminiscent of small-cap, mid-cap, sectoral, thematic, and a few debt funds, are usually not included on this initiative to guard novice traders from volatility.

Advantages of Sachetisation for Traders

 

Sachetisation won’t simply be a coverage transfer; it has the potential of a monetary revolution aimed toward democratising funding alternatives in India. The initiative supplies a number of advantages:

 

1. Monetary Inclusion

By permitting investments with as little as Rs. 250, sachetisation will make the mutual fund market accessible to individuals from all financial backgrounds, making certain that wealth creation just isn’t restricted to the prosperous.

 

2. Encourages a Behavior of Saving

The low funding threshold will encourage disciplined funding conduct. Even those that have by no means invested earlier than can begin small and step by step construct their portfolios over time.

 

3. Market Participation for the Plenty

The broader the investor base, the extra secure and inclusive the monetary markets grow to be. Sachetisation might be certain that wealth creation alternatives prolong past city traders to semi-urban and rural areas.

 

4. Threat Mitigation Via SIPs

By investing in small quantities commonly, traders might profit from rupee price averaging, lowering the affect of market volatility. This can notably be useful for people unfamiliar with market fluctuations.

 

5. Progress Potential for Mutual Fund Trade

With a wider investor base, mutual fund corporations will  additionally expertise elevated participation, resulting in extra strong development within the business.

Components to Take into account Earlier than Investing in Sachetised Mutual Funds

 

Whereas sachetisation may make investing straightforward, traders should take sure precautions to make sure they make the suitable choices, when carried out:

 

1. Perceive Funding Targets

Earlier than beginning an SIP, traders ought to outline their targets—whether or not it’s saving for emergencies, schooling, retirement, or different monetary objectives.

 

2. Assess Threat Tolerance

Though sachetised mutual funds are designed to be comparatively protected, understanding threat ranges related to completely different fund classes is essential.

 

3. Monitor Fund Efficiency

Repeatedly reviewing how the mutual fund is performing will be certain that traders could make knowledgeable choices about persevering with, modifying, or stopping their investments.

 

4. Keep away from Overcommitting

Whereas the funding quantity is small, traders ought to nonetheless assess their monetary capability earlier than beginning a number of SIPs to stop monetary pressure.

 

5. Know the Exit Situations

Though traders are inspired to remain invested for at the very least 5 years, they need to learn all scheme associated paperwork rigorously for making an knowledgeable choice.
